设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 1525|回复: 5
打印 上一主题 下一主题

[已经解决] 关于文章显示的脚本

[复制链接]

Lv1.梦旅人

梦石
0
星屑
50
在线时间
10 小时
注册时间
2012-2-22
帖子
14
跳转到指定楼层
1
发表于 2012-5-28 13:28:45 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
课件需要,很多的文章内容只能用脚本处理。请问应该如何用脚本显示多个文章内容?
我在论坛只看到了XP的脚本,vx的摸了几天也没摸出个所以然来。请各位不吝赐教。
XP的脚本:
@message_waiting = true
$game_temp.message_proc = Proc.new {
@message_waiting = false }
$game_temp.message_text = "你好,66RPG!"

Lv2.观梦者

梦石
0
星屑
690
在线时间
791 小时
注册时间
2011-10-20
帖子
2394

开拓者

2
发表于 2012-5-28 13:45:44 | 只看该作者
显示文章:
$game_message.texts.push("****")
显示引号中的文章。一般要配合初始化显示文章使用。

更改文章选项:
$game_message.position = 0,1,2
表示上、中、下,三个位置

更改文章背景:
$game_message.background = 0 ,1,2
表示普通窗口、背景变暗、透明,三种效果
欢迎点此进入我的egames.wink.ws,有RMQQ堂等

[url=http://rpg.blue/thread-317273-1-1.html]短篇八-赶选

http://yun.baidu.com/share/link?shareid=2158225779&uk=169642147&third=0


历险ARPG赢回你的疆域新的战斗模式?…………点击这里:[宋乱贼狂 for QQ堂]
http://rpg.blue/group-368-1.html
programing ....?
[url=http://rpg.blue/thrd-234658-1-1.html]
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
10 小时
注册时间
2012-2-22
帖子
14
3
 楼主| 发表于 2012-5-28 14:38:24 | 只看该作者
end55rpg 发表于 2012-5-28 13:45
显示文章:
$game_message.texts.push("****")
显示引号中的文章。一般要配合初始化显示文章使用。

这个我知道,问题是:怎样初始化显示文章?
如果单纯用这几行,文章并不能正常显示出来,直到遇到一个“文章”事件。


‘‘──bearadam于2012-5-28 16:38补充以下内容:

天哪,怎么没有人答复我呢?
’’
回复

使用道具 举报

Lv3.寻梦者

梦石
0
星屑
1444
在线时间
1592 小时
注册时间
2010-11-6
帖子
3193

贵宾

4
发表于 2012-5-28 17:04:43 手机端发表。 | 只看该作者
很简单,把课文复制,在文本输入框中勾选“批量输入文本”,粘贴课文,再确认看看。xp没有这个功能哦
走你耶。
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
10 小时
注册时间
2012-2-22
帖子
14
5
 楼主| 发表于 2012-5-28 17:19:31 | 只看该作者
yychchhh 发表于 2012-5-28 17:04
很简单,把课文复制,在文本输入框中勾选“批量输入文本”,粘贴课文,再确认看看。xp没有这个功能哦 ...

不好意思,我没有描述清楚。
我要求的功能是: 调用自写的DLL读取数据库中的题库,用脚本在游戏文章中显示DLL中返回的题目,再调用DLL等候学生输入文字,如果学生输入的文字和题目答案吻合,就执行加分送宝等操作。DLL返回的题目和答案是文本,所以我需要在脚本中输出,可是我发现用"#{@mytext}".split(/\n/).each &$game_message.texts.method(:push)输出的文本并不马上出现,而是等到“文章”事件发生的时候一起再出来,如此一来学生输入答题的过程就出现在题目呈现之前。折腾了几天,无法解决这个问题。请求大家帮助。
回复

使用道具 举报

Lv2.观梦者

梦石
0
星屑
690
在线时间
791 小时
注册时间
2011-10-20
帖子
2394

开拓者

6
发表于 2012-5-28 19:24:56 | 只看该作者
初始化显示文章:
set_message_waiting
注:这个用了以后下一次显示文章时的文章选项、背景恢复正常,如果不用这个的话所有显示的文章将并在一个框里,有兴趣的去试一下。
好了吧!
欢迎点此进入我的egames.wink.ws,有RMQQ堂等

[url=http://rpg.blue/thread-317273-1-1.html]短篇八-赶选

http://yun.baidu.com/share/link?shareid=2158225779&uk=169642147&third=0


历险ARPG赢回你的疆域新的战斗模式?…………点击这里:[宋乱贼狂 for QQ堂]
http://rpg.blue/group-368-1.html
programing ....?
[url=http://rpg.blue/thrd-234658-1-1.html]
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-11-25 16:04

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表